About Joy Davis
Joy Davis is a scholar working on Surgery, Genetics, Molecular Biology,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and Pharmacology, having authored 11 papers that have together received 531 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Pancreatic function and diabetes (8 papers), Diabetes and associated disorders (5 papers), Metabolism, Diabetes, and Cancer (3 papers), Genetics and Neurodevelopmental Disorders (3 papers), Cannabis and Cannabinoid Research (2 papers), Cardiac electrophysiology and arrhythmias (1 paper), Diabetes Management and Research (1 paper) and Neuroscience and Neural Engineering (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(165 citations), Genetics (257 citations), Immunology (187 citations), Surgery (246 citations) and Pharmacology (63 citations). Joy Davis has collaborated with scholars based in Canada, Switzerland and United States. Frequent co-authors include Christian Toso, Juliet Emamaullee, Shaheed Merani, Aducio Thiesen, John F. Elliott, A. M. James Shapiro, Rena Pawlick, Tatsuya Kin, A. M. James Shapiro and Michael McCall. Their work appears in journals such as Diabetes, Endocrinology, Transplant International, Surgery and Cell Transplantation.
